“And We have instructed man to be good to his parents.
His mother carried him through hardship upon hardship, and his weaning is in two years.
Be grateful to Me and to your parents. To Me is the final return.”
— Surah Luqman, 31:14
“When death comes to one of them, he says, ‘My Lord, send me back so I can do good in what I left behind.’
No! It is only a word he is saying.
And behind them is a barrier until the Day they are resurrected.”
— Surah Al-Mu’minun, 23:99–100
“Whoever kills a soul—unless for a life or for spreading corruption in the land—
it is as if he had killed all of mankind.
And whoever saves a life, it is as if he had saved all of mankind.”
— Surah Al-Mā’idah, 5:32
“Wherever you may be, death will find you—even if you are in strong, high towers.”
— Surah An-Nisa, 4:78
The Messenger of Allah ﷺ said:
“Indeed, Allah does not look at your appearance or your wealth, but He looks at your hearts and your deeds.”
— Narrated by Muslim, no. 2564
